Does electrolysis remove white hair?
Answered by Eva Taub
Yes — and for many women, it’s the missing piece of the puzzle.
One of the most common things I hear is: “My laser removed almost everything… but these stubborn white hairs are still there.” The first thing I tell them is that nothing went wrong.
Laser hair removal works by targeting the pigment inside the hair. Dark hairs contain plenty of pigment, so the laser can find them and permanently damage the follicle. White and gray hairs have lost that pigment, which means there isn’t enough pigment for the laser to recognize. It simply passes over them.
That’s where electrolysis becomes so valuable. Unlike laser, electrolysis doesn’t depend on hair color. Every hair is treated individually by placing a tiny probe into the natural opening of the follicle and delivering a controlled electrical current. Whether the hair is black, brown, blonde, gray, or completely white doesn’t matter. The treatment works because it’s targeting the follicle itself, not the pigment inside the hair.
After more than forty years treating hormonal facial hair, menopause-related hair, and PCOS, I’ve found that many women eventually benefit from both treatments. Laser efficiently removes the dark hairs, while electrolysis permanently removes the white and gray hairs that laser will never be able to treat.
Laser and electrolysis aren’t competitors. They’re partners. When each is used for the job it does best, the results are far more complete than relying on either treatment alone.
